]> git.ipfire.org Git - thirdparty/gcc.git/commit - gcc/opts.c
opts.h: Include obstack.h.
authorJakub Jelinek <jakub@redhat.com>
Wed, 27 Feb 2013 07:28:09 +0000 (08:28 +0100)
committerJakub Jelinek <jakub@gcc.gnu.org>
Wed, 27 Feb 2013 07:28:09 +0000 (08:28 +0100)
commitdc3577989d23572bc6f695e791eeaad33cfe8f6a
treebd4cfc1abd9fbaa6e8743ef8ed88707b9b753706
parentf5c2cacaad0d670aee9993c31c0eb93887e49d33
opts.h: Include obstack.h.

* opts.h: Include obstack.h.
(opts_concat): New prototype.
(opts_obstack): New declaration.
* opts.c (opts_concat): New function.
(opts_obstack): New variable.
(init_options_struct): Call gcc_init_obstack on opts_obstack.
(finish_options): Use opts_concat instead of concat
and XOBNEWVEC instead of XNEWVEC.
* opts-common.c (generate_canonical_option, decode_cmdline_option,
generate_option): Likewise.
* Makefile.in (OPTS_H): Depend on $(OBSTACK_H).
* lto-wrapper.c (main): Call gcc_init_obstack on opts_obstack.

From-SVN: r196305
gcc/ChangeLog
gcc/Makefile.in
gcc/lto-wrapper.c
gcc/opts-common.c
gcc/opts.c
gcc/opts.h